Webb24 nov. 2024 · A normal vitamin B12 level generally falls between 200 to 800 picograms per milliliter (pg/mL). If your result is between 200 and 300 pg/mL, your result is considered borderline, and your doctor may have you retake the vitamin B12 test or undergo additional testing. Values less than 200 pg/mL indicate a vitamin B12 deficiency.

WebbPatients with serum vitamin B12 levels between 150 and 400 ng/L are considered borderline deficient and should be evaluated further by functional tests for vitamin B12 deficiency. Plasma homocysteine measurement (HCYSP / Homocysteine, Total, Plasma) is a good screening test where a normal level effectively excludes vitamin B12 and folate …
